Fort Worth, Tx vs Moca Climate & Distance Between

Dominican Republic flag
  • The distance between Fort Worth, Tx, Usa and Moca, Dominican Republic is approximately 3,030 km or 1,883 mi.
  • To reach Fort Worth, Tx in this distance one would set out from Moca bearing 305.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Fort Worth, Tx bearing 293.1° or WNW .
  • Fort Worth,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Moca has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
  • Fort Worth,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Moca is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 6.3 °C (11.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.9 °C (35.8°F) more in Fort Worth, Tx.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 375.2 mm (14.8 in) less which is equivalent to 375.2 l/m² (9.21 US gal/ft²) or 3,752,000 l/ha (401,114 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.4° lower in Fort Worth, Tx than in Moca.
